Climate & Environmental Factors in Briggsville, WI

Briggsville experiences a humid continental climate with cold winters, warm summers, and moderate annual precipitation. Winter brings heavy snowfall, freezing temperatures, and ice accumulation that place significant stress on tree branches. Spring often includes strong storms and gusty winds, while summer heat and humidity encourage rapid tree growth. Seasonal weather fluctuations directly impact tree stability and health. Snow and ice accumulation frequently cause limbs to crack or entire trees to uproot, particularly when root systems are weakened by saturated soil. High winds during spring and summer storms can split trunks or push leaning trees toward homes and barns.


These environmental factors increase the need for Tree Removals in Briggsville, WI, especially after severe weather events. Prompt removal reduces the risk of structural damage and power outages. Additionally, Wisconsin’s climate supports insect activity and fungal diseases that compromise tree integrity. Emerald ash borer infestations and rot caused by excess moisture can weaken internal structures without visible warning signs. Clay-rich soils in parts of Columbia County may shift during freeze-thaw cycles, destabilizing root systems. Local Challenges Related to Tree Removals in Briggsville, WI

Property owners in Briggsville often face challenges related to aging trees growing close to homes, garages, and agricultural buildings. Many properties include decades-old hardwoods that have expanded beyond safe distances from structures. Over time, roots may interfere with foundations or driveways, while overhanging limbs threaten roofs and utility lines. Without proper Tree Removals in Briggsville, WI, these risks can escalate quickly. The rural layout of the community presents additional complexities. Limited access points and narrow driveways require strategic equipment placement during removal. Farm properties may include fencing, livestock areas, and storage buildings that must remain protected throughout the process. Seasonal weather conditions further complicate removal, particularly when frozen ground or muddy terrain affects machinery stability.

Frequently asked questions

When should a tree be removed?

Trees should be removed when they show severe decay, structural instability, storm damage, or disease. Professional evaluation determines whether removal is necessary to protect nearby structures and ensure safety.

Is tree removal dangerous?

Yes, tree removal involves significant risk without proper training and equipment. Hiring experienced professionals reduces injury hazards and prevents property damage during dismantling and debris removal.

Do you provide emergency tree removal?

Yes, emergency tree removal services are available following storms or sudden tree failure. Prompt response helps secure properties and restore safe access to driveways and buildings.

How long does tree removal take?

Removal time depends on tree size, location, and complexity. Smaller trees may take a few hours, while larger or hazardous removals require additional planning and equipment.

What happens to the debris?

All debris is removed or processed according to your preference. We offer complete cleanup services, including hauling, chipping, and environmentally responsible disposal of wood materials.

Can stump grinding prevent regrowth?

Yes, stump grinding removes the remaining base of the tree, preventing regrowth and eliminating tripping hazards while improving the appearance and usability of your landscape.
